Frequently Asked Questions about Studio Kew Gardens Hills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Kew Gardens Hills with Studio?

Currently the most affordable Studio in Kew Gardens Hills is at Park Haven listed at $1,899.

How much is the average rent for a Studio Kew Gardens Hills Apartment?

The average rent for a Studio Apartment in Kew Gardens Hills is $3,246.

What is the largest available Studio Kew Gardens Hills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Kew Gardens Hills is a 619 square feet unit starting from $2,880 at Parker Towers.

What is the average size for Kew Gardens Hills Studio Apartments for rent?

The average size for a Studio rental in Kew Gardens Hills is currently 777 sq ft.
